describe('#toBeRejectedWithMatching', function() { it('passes if the promise is rejected with something matching the predicate', function() { const matcher = privateUnderTest.asyncMatchers.toBeRejectedWithMatching(); const actual = Promise.reject(new Error('nope')); const predicate = value => value.message === 'nope'; return matcher.compare(actual, predicate).then(function(result) { expect(result).toEqual(jasmine.objectContaining({ pass: true })); }); }); it('fails if the promise resolves', function() { const matcher = privateUnderTest.asyncMatchers.toBeRejectedWithMatching(); const actual = Promise.resolve(); const predicate = () => true; return matcher.compare(actual, predicate).then(function(result) { expect(result).toEqual(jasmine.objectContaining({ pass: false })); }); }); it('fails if the promise is rejected with something not matching the predicate', function() { const matcher = privateUnderTest.asyncMatchers.toBeRejectedWithMatching(); const actual = Promise.reject('A Bad Apple'); const predicate = value => value === 'A Good Orange'; return matcher.compare(actual, predicate).then(function(result) { expect(result).toEqual( jasmine.objectContaining({ pass: false, message: 'Expected a promise to be rejected matching a predicate, but the predicate returned "false".' }) ); }); }); it('should build its error correctly when negated', function() { const matcher = privateUnderTest.asyncMatchers.toBeRejectedWithMatching(); const actual = Promise.reject(true); const predicate = () => true; return matcher.compare(actual, predicate).then(function(result) { expect(result).toEqual( jasmine.objectContaining({ pass: true, message: 'Expected a promise not to be rejected matching a predicate, but the predicate returned "true".' }) ); }); }); it('fails if actual is not a promise', function() { const matcher = privateUnderTest.asyncMatchers.toBeRejectedWithMatching(); const actual = 'not a promise'; function f() { return matcher.compare(actual); } expect(f).toThrowError( 'Expected toBeRejectedWithMatching to be called on a promise but was on a string.' ); }); it('fails if predicate is not a function', function() { const matcher = privateUnderTest.asyncMatchers.toBeRejectedWithMatching(); const actual = Promise.resolve(); const predicate = 'not a function'; function f() { return matcher.compare(actual, predicate); } expect(f).toThrowError(/Predicate is not a Function/); }); });
